About the Name Lilymay
Lilymay has seen a notable decline in recent years, dropping 3030 places in five years. It was most popular in 2010 at #1520 — parents choosing it today are making a deliberately counter-trend decision. The name has been a regular feature in UK records since 2000.
Lilymay is rare in the UK, so your child is very likely to be the only Lilymay in their class.
